CAHOKIA, ILL. — Cambridge has provided a $3.9 million HUD first mortgage loan for the refinancing of Cahokia Nursing and Rehabilitation Center in Cahokia. The skilled-care nursing facility offers 150 beds. The fully amortized, 35-year term loan was arranged for the undisclosed property owners using HUD's Section 232 pursuant to Section 223(a)(7) funding program. The loan was underwritten by Cambridge Realty Capital Ltd. of Illinois.

RIVERDALE, ILL. — Turnstone Development Corp. has completed reconstruction and renovation of Riverdale Senior Apartments, which is located at 335 West 138th Street in Riversdale. The five-story, 52-unit building offers 43 one-bedroom apartments and nine two-bedroom units, in a combination of public and affordable housing. Additionally, the building features three ADA accessible units and eight ADA adaptable units. Reconstruction of the 45-year-old building included the addition of a community room, an on-site laundry facility, two new elevators and a general social services offices. McShane Construction, which served as general contractor for the project, completed tuckpointing, balcony refurbishing, replacement of all windows and roofing materials and provided new entryway canopies. McShane also installed a new fire sprinkler system, electrical and plumping updates and a modernized HVAC system. The project received funding from the American Reinvestment and Recovery Act through the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development, the Housing Authority of the County of Cook, Ill., and the County of Cook's Department of Planning and Development. Piekarz Associates PC provided architectural services for the project.

MESA, ARIZ. — Marcus & Millichap has brokered the almost $12.86 million sale of the 126-unit Cypress Court assisted-living and memory care property, located at 310 South 63rd St. in Mesa. The three-story, 81,995-square-foot property includes a main dining room, a dietary department, administrative offices, three elevators and a central courtyard. Marcus & Millichap’s Mark Myers, David Guido and Joshua Jandris represented an Indiana-based nonprofit in its disposition of the 145-bed property to Emeritus Senior Living.

NEW YORK CITY — Massey Knakal Realty Services has completed the sale of an assisted living facility in Manhattan's Greenwich Village neighborhood for $33.25 million. The seven-story property is located at 607-09 Hudson St. and was converted from a hotel into a nursing home in 1958. the seller was VillageCare, which relocated to a new building at 510 W. Houston St. The buyer, FLAnk, plans to redevelop the building into for-sale condominiums. Massey Knakal's James Nelson and Paul Massey arranged the deal on behalf of the seller.

SCOTTSDALE, ARIZ. — Plaza Companies and Vi Living have completed the development of Vi at Silverstone — A Vi Living and Plaza Companies Community, which is located at 23005 N. 74th St. in Scottsdale. The $270 million, 735,650-square-foot four-story development includes 203 independent-living units, 67 single-family villas and 60 units licensed as assisted-living, memory-support and skilled-nursing beds. Additionally, the community features an 18-hole championship golf course.

TEMECULA, CALIF. — CB Richard Ellis (CBRE) has brokered the sale of a Temecula senior housing community for $27.15 million. The Sterling at Vintage Hills contains 152 units and was 95 percent occupied at the time of closing. It is located on 10 acres at 41780 Butterfield Stage Road and includes a 9-acre parcel for future expansion. David Rothschild, Matthew Whitlock and Mary Christian of CBRE”s National Senior Housing Group represented the seller, an affiliate of Irvine, Calif.-based MBK Senior Living. The team also procured the buyer, Washington, D.C.-based CSH.

LAKE FOREST, ILL. — Lake Forest-based Green Courte Partners has acquired a portfolio of six age-restricted land-lease communities in central Florida. The nearly 100 percent portfolio contains more than 1,850 home sites. Green Courte has retained American Land Lease, a wholly owned subsidiary of its second fund Green Courte Real Estate Partners II, to manage the six communities. Terms of the transaction were not released.

BRYAN, BUCYRUS AND UPPER SANDUSKY, OHIO — Red Capital Advisors has provided $19.2 million in bridge financing to Premier Senior Living for the acquisition of three senior-living communities in Ohio. The communities are the 93-unit The Inn at Fountain Park in Bryan, the 40-unit The Inn at Orchard Park in Bucyrus and the 50-unit The Inn at Westbrook in Upper Sandusky. James Sherman of Red originated the transactions.

ABILENE — The Ensign Group has acquired Wisteria Place, a continuing care retirement community, and its sister facility, Wisteria Independent Living, both in Abilene. The facilities will be operated by a subsidiary of Keystone Care, Ensign's Texas-based portfolio subsidiary. Wisteria Place is a full-service care campus located at 3202 S. Willis St. in Abilene that operates 123 skilled nursing beds, 77 assisted living units and 20 independent living cottages. Wisteria Independent Living is located at 3917 Wisteria Way in Abilene and operates 72 independent living units.
